Oildale residents without power for hours after vehicle hit overhead wires
More than 100 without electricity

OILDALE, Calif. - A knocked-out power grid in Oildale left more than a hundred people without electricity last night.
The power went out after an Excavater hit some over-head wires on the south side of Olive Drive last night, just west of the 99 on-ramp.
It left many homes and businesses along the south side of Olive Drive without electricity for about two hours.
Power was restored and the accident is not expected to cause any problems during the morning commute.
